Collaboration & Integration Key to Medical Additive Manufacturing

Additive Manufacturing

GE Healthcare is a leader in collaborations, leveraging their diagnostics and imaging expertise to work with Formlabs, a developer of 3D printers and materials; CMR Surgical, specializing in surgical robots; and Decisio Health, a virtual care monitoring company.
